Default dec-jan weather

What is it typical like in these months. What is the best months for Rocks off the beach?

Usually second week in Dec seems to be the best down Avon/Buxton way until mid Jan. but fish pretty much stayed north entire winter last year. Some years they start to arrive at OI Thanksgiving.
